Eco-Friendly Paver Options
Eco-conscious hardscaping are rising in popularity due to their stormwater management. These systems allow rain to seep through the ground, reducing runoff and preventing erosion — a critical feature for slope-prone yards. Used in walkways, permeable pavers pair modern design with certified hardscape installer expertise for lasting results.

Sub-Base Build and Compaction
Proper base preparation is the backbone of any retaining wall construction. Layers of crushed stone are stabilized using professional equipment to create a load-bearing foundation. Without adequate sub-grade density, even the best concrete pavers can shift, crack, or sink. This phase is non-negotiable for King County outdoor projects built to last.

Keeping Weeds Out of Hardscape
Weeds creeping through paver joints aren’t just unsightly—they signal weak filler material. A stabilized sand creates a durable barrier that stops growth while anchoring pavers in place. For added defense, a eco-safe herbicide or vinegar-based spray controls early sprouts without affecting your landscape lighting or drainage solutions.
Correcting Sinking Walkways
Sunken pavers or walkways are usually caused by shifted foundation support. Left unrepaired, they become trip hazards in your outdoor living space. A hardscape repair services pro will re-level the affected stones, stabilize the base, and reinstall pavers for a durable finish.

Soil Types in Sammamish
Sammamish soil often includes heavy clay and glacial till, which shifts when wet. This creates risks for drainage failures if not properly managed. A certified hardscape contractor adjusts base depth, compaction methods, and useful reference drainage solutions to match these conditions. They may use geotextile fabric to ensure your retaining wall construction or paver patio installation remains solid for decades.
